Symptom No power. No picture on the LCD or TV (including video from another unit). Cause • The power cord is disconnected. • The battery is discharged, • The video cable is not connected securely. • LCD mode is set to OFF. Correction " Plug the power cord into the wall outlet securely. . Recharge the battery. • Connect the video cable into the jacks securely.
